基于信息技术的车辆租赁管理系统设计

需积分: 9 0 下载量 134 浏览量 更新于2024-07-09 收藏 1.54MB DOCX 举报
"这是一个关于汽车租赁系统的项目设计文档,包括了系统开发的背景、技术选型、功能模块设计以及性能需求分析。该系统基于MVC架构,使用Oracle数据库,并在SSH框架上进行实现。" 这篇论文主要探讨了一个车辆租赁管理信息系统的开发,其核心目标是利用先进的信息技术提升车辆租赁行业的管理效率和智能化程度。随着电子信息技术的快速发展,信息化在各个领域的应用日益广泛,车辆租赁行业也不例外。系统设计者选择基于MVC(Model-View-Controller)模式进行开发,这种模式能够清晰地分离业务逻辑、用户界面和数据管理,有利于系统的维护和扩展。 数据库选用Oracle,这是一款功能强大且稳定性高的关系型数据库管理系统,适合处理大量的租赁管理数据。SSH(Struts+Spring+Hibernate)框架则为系统提供了基础的结构和数据访问支持,这三个框架的结合使得系统开发更加高效,同时也便于后期的维护和升级。 系统设计主要包括以下几个功能模块: 1. 系统管理:这部分涉及系统的初始化设置、权限管理和用户管理,确保系统的正常运行和安全。 2. 参数管理:允许管理员设定和调整租赁业务的各种参数,如租金计算规则、租赁期限等。 3. 运营监控:实时监控车辆的租赁状态,提供车辆分布、租赁情况的可视化展示。 4. 运营分析:通过对租赁数据的统计和分析,帮助决策者了解业务状况,优化运营策略。 5. 运行监控:监控系统的运行状态,及时发现并解决问题,保证服务的连续性。 在非功能需求方面,论文着重讨论了系统的属性需求,如系统的可靠性、可用性、可维护性和安全性,这些都是保证系统稳定运行的关键因素。此外,还考虑了系统外部接口的需求,确保系统能与其他系统或设备无缝对接。 性能设计是系统开发的核心环节,涵盖了响应时间、并发处理能力、数据处理速度等方面,以确保系统在高负载下仍能保持良好的性能。通过实际测试和监控,验证了系统设计的有效性,达到了预期的目标,为车辆租赁管理提供了更高效的工作流程。 关键词:车辆租赁、信息管理、在线租赁、软件工程 这篇论文不仅提供了车辆租赁管理信息系统的全面设计,还为类似项目的开发提供了参考,对于理解如何利用信息技术改进传统行业的管理方式具有重要意义。